I've just read yet another blog peddling the idea that the mandate for a new independence referendum is entirely conditional on Brexit. This is based solely on a single phrase abstracted from a section of the SNP's 2016 election manifesto - “taken out of the EU”. But it doesn't just say “taken out of the … Continue reading A bad place
